Not sure how many of you watched the game but D'antoni deserves a lot of the blame for the Knicks losing this one. He let Beasley and Love basically beat them alone in the 2nd half. How about calling a time out and telling the team to run the offense not taking quick 3's especially up double digits. The team is money on free throws but keeps taking 3's instead Chandler and Gallo 17 combined 3 pt attempts wow. D'antoni doesn't double Beasley make Telfair hit a shot he wasn't looking to score at all. Also Amare is the leader of the team and while the team is blowing the lead your best player is on the bench he played a minute in the 3rd qtr while the lead shrunk from 21 to 7. If you see Amare in the locker room after the game he was dejected not used to losing and he wanted to be out there. The lineup of Chandler at PF and Amare at Center isn't working. Need to start Amare at Pf and Mozgov at Center till Turiaf comes back even if he's foul prone at least he's a 7 footer. Chandler had 6 rebs playing 42 mins that won't get it done for your PF. Knicks are 9th in the league in rebounding but obviously with Turiaf hurt and Amare sitting with foul trouble their not the same team on the boards. Also Bill Walker gets no mins with so many guys struggling and Walker is a guy who has range and can get to the rim.
Turiaf is already out so the only bigs they have are Mozgov, Amare and Antony Randolph. Basically Love is man handling the Knicks esp. in the 3rd qtr he had 15 rebs in the 3rd qtr alone.
